The Romanée St Vivant DRC 1998 is a distinguished Grand Cru Burgundy from Domaine de la Romanée-Conti, an estate with a long-standing commitment to terroir expression on the Côte d`Or. The wine presents a mix of redcurrants, dark cherries and a subtle floral character, alongside hints of damp earth and spice. Its palate demonstrates a refined structure, with balanced acidity and elegant tannins. The finish reveals a depth typical of this celebrated vineyard, making it suitable for both immediate enjoyment and further maturation.
90
Vinous
- Saturated ruby-red. Sappy, rather wild aromas of raspberry, smoke, tar and mulch; more deeply pitched than the Grands-Echezeaux but still quite tangy. Fat, sweet and full, but less precise and lively than the Grands-Echezeaux; flavors of redcurrant and iron. Fairly rich wine, finishing with good breadth and dusty, slightly dry tannins. I'd be a bit more optimistic about the ultimate potential of this wine if it were more primary today.
